Closed Bug 1797081 Opened 3 years ago Closed 3 years ago

Add cookie banner service mode prefs to the telemetry environment

Categories

(Core :: Privacy: Anti-Tracking, task)

task

Tracking

()

RESOLVED FIXED
109 Branch
Tracking Status
firefox109 --- fixed

People

(Reporter: timhuang, Assigned: timhuang)

References

Details

Attachments

(4 files)

Adding cookei banner service mode prefs

Paul and I think that we should use glean to implement the telemetry. But, unfortunately, glean doesn't support environment prefs, so we have to implement a way to watch the prefs with time. The simplest way is that we collect the pref values in the idle-daily and we can implement it in the cookieBannerService.

Also, we need to watch the pref related to the preference UI here.

Assignee: nobody → tihuang
Status: NEW → ASSIGNED
Attachment #9301215 - Flags: data-review?(chutten)

Comment on attachment 9301215 [details]
data-request-Bug1797081.md

PRELIMINARY NOTES:

Since these collections are Glean in Firefox Desktop you can use ./mach data-review <bug number> to auto-fill a data review request template with information you provided in the metrics' definitions and save you some time, next time.

DATA COLLECTION REVIEW RESPONSE:

Is there or will there be documentation that describes the schema for the ultimate data set available publicly, complete and accurate?

Yes.

Is there a control mechanism that allows the user to turn the data collection on and off?

Yes. This collection is Telemetry so can be controlled through Firefox's Preferences.

If the request is for permanent data collection, is there someone who will monitor the data over time?

Yes, Tim Huang is responsible.

Using the category system of data types on the Mozilla wiki, what collection type of data do the requested measurements fall under?

Category 2, Interaction.

Is the data collection request for default-on or default-off?

Default on for all channels.

Does the instrumentation include the addition of any new identifiers?

No.

Is the data collection covered by the existing Firefox privacy notice?

Yes.

Does the data collection use a third-party collection tool?

No.


Result: datareview+

Attachment #9301215 - Flags: data-review?(chutten) → data-review+

We record the cookie banner service mode prefs in the 'idle-daily'
observer. This would allow us to observe the pref changes with time.

Depends on D161285

Pushed by tihuang@mozilla.com: https://hg.mozilla.org/integration/autoland/rev/3f836bc56419 Part 1: Add metrics.yaml to the cookie banner component. r=pbz https://hg.mozilla.org/integration/autoland/rev/7fecdbd628a9 Part 2: Record the cookie banner service mode prefs daily. r=pbz https://hg.mozilla.org/integration/autoland/rev/67041f916c88 Part 3: Add a test for the cookie banner telemetry. r=pbz
Blocks: 1800521
Status: ASSIGNED → RESOLVED
Closed: 3 years ago
Resolution: --- → FIXED
Target Milestone: --- → 109 Branch
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: